A lively, calligraphy-inspired italic with gently tapered terminals and smooth, looping entry and exit strokes. The letterforms lean consistently and keep a relatively even stroke color, with rounded bowls and softly bracketed joins that create a continuous, pen-drawn rhythm. Capitals are more decorative, featuring prominent swashes and curved arms, while the lowercase stays readable with simple stems and occasional hooks. Numerals follow the same handwritten logic, using open curves and modest flourishes for a cohesive texture in text.

The overall tone feels warm and personable while still carrying a formal, old-world polish. Its subtle swashes and curved terminals add a slightly whimsical, storybook character without becoming overly ornate.
Designed to evoke formal pen lettering with a gentle, approachable twist—combining readable, unconnected forms with decorative capital flourishes and a steady, flowing italic rhythm.
The italic slant and curled terminals create a flowing baseline rhythm, and the more expressive capitals can act as built-in emphasis for initials or short headings. Some glyphs show handwritten asymmetry and individualized shapes, reinforcing an authentic pen-made impression.
